A Lasting Impression at ICFF - Scale Wallpaper


Yesterday I went to the ICFF looking for anything that would turn my head in a new direction. I found it at Catherine Hammerton Textiles and was lucky enough to meet Catherine herself.

The wallpaper that drew me in is a classic fish scale pattern, similar to that found on the outside of old Victorian clapboard houses. Raised, it offers both texture and style. I could hardly resist the urge to run my hand over it. Note to self regarding this temptation - very cute but definitely not for kids rooms. I imagine it on one wall of a bedroom behind the bed or a living room. It could even be placed in a large frame as contemporary art. The possibilities are endless...

The hand cut and sewn paper is available in your choice of colors - custom made specifically to order. The impression for me was immediate and lasting...
